College is what is expected, but it is not for everyone and it is not an immediate path to success either. I do not think I would have opted to not go to college, but that does not mean every young adult finishing high school should do it.Hannah Hampton wrote: ↑29 Nov 2022, 20:44 How did everybody feel about Rusk criticizing college as the default option for young adults? Do you think he supported his argument that a college degree is not necessary to live a full and successful life?
Rusk might not give a convincing argument for everyone, but I appreciate the fact that he is starting a conversation around it.
Also: college is not the only way to learn and grow as a person.
